Some tests, which are related to pyexpat, get failed with `./configure 
--with-system-expat`.
```
11 tests failed:                       
    test_minidom test_multiprocessing_fork                                      
                         
    test_multiprocessing_forkserver test_multiprocessing_spawn
    test_plistlib test_pulldom test_pyexpat test_sax test_xml_etree
    test_xml_etree_c test_xmlrpc
```

Since 3.10.0b2, `Modules/pyexpat.c` has been broken.
I guess this is caused by accessing freed memory.
For more detail, please refer to the attached file.
